The Belhedi Trophy
On 1 November 2008, the Belhedi Trophy was presented for the first time at the CSA Ltd Annual Dinner in Dover. The trophy was established by the CSA Ltd for the swim on the highest tide - Nejib swam the Channel in 1993 on a tide of over 7 metres. The Montserrat Tresserras Trophy
Nejib was awarded the Montserrat Tresserras Trophy by the Channel Swimming Association in 1993 for becoming the first Tunisian and first North African to swim the Channel.
